PROCEDURE

实验过程

Under nitrogen, a mixture of 4-[4-(1-benzofuran-5-yl)phenyl]-5-[(3S)-3-pyrrolidinylmethyl]-2,4-dihydro-3H-1,2,4-triazol-3-one hydrochloride (116 mg, 0.292 mmol) and N,N-diisopropylethylamine (0.15 mL, 0.88 mmol) in dichloromethane (1.3 mL) was stirred at room temperature for 2 min. The mixture was cooled to 0° C. and treated with propionyl chloride (0.026 mL, 0.292 mmol) dropwise by syringe. The mixture became a dark brown solution and the reaction was stirred at 0° C. for 90 min. The reaction was quenched with water (2 mL) and diluted with ethyl acetate (20 mL). The mixture was transferred to a separatory funnel, water (10 mL) was added and the layers were separated. The pH of the aqueous layer was tested by pH paper and found to be pH˜5-6. The aqueous layer was extracted with ethyl acetate (10 mL). The organic layers were combined, dried over magnesium sulfate and concentrated in vacuo to give a tan foamy solid. Purification of the residue by silica gel chromatography (Analogix IF280, SF10-4 g, 0-10% MeOH/EtOAc, 30 min) provided the title product as an ivory solid (74 mg, 61%). MS(ES)+ m/e 417.2 [M+H]+.
